Linking/Pairing
To use the Twiins® HF1.0 Dual + HF2.0 Dual, it’s necessary to pair it to the Bluetooth® device you wish to connect it to (mobile phone, G PS
navigator). While the device is switched off, hold the control button (1b) until the LED indicator (1a) begins flashing in Red and Blue. The
mobile phone or GPS navigator will find the device under the name HF1.0 Dual + HF2.0 Dual. Select the HF1.0 Dual or HF2.0 Dual
device and, if necessary, enter the access code: 0000.
NOTE: Pairing is a process that only needs to be completed once. When the Twiins® HF1.0 Dual + HF2.0 Dual is paired to a specific device,
both devices will connect automatically when switched off and on.
NOTE: Depending on your phone’s Operating System software version, there is a possibility that during the phone’s Bluetooth® device
search you have to turn off the phone’s Bluetooth® functionality and turn on again after 2 or 3 seconds so that the Twiins® device is
found properly. This is normal and it should only happen during the first pairing with that phone.

Switching on/off

Switching off: press and hold the control button (1b) for a few seconds until the speakers provides an acoustic signal and the LED
indicator (1a) begins flashing in red before the device powers off.

Switching on: press and hold the button (1b) for a few seconds until the speakers provides an acoustic signal and the LED indicator
(1a) begins to flash in Blue.
